Fast Forward to earlier this week.
I attended another shotgun class at Front Sight. This time I had done more work on the gun to include improved sling positioning, a different Recoil Pad and most importantly a barrel which has been given the Vang Comp Treatment, which includes lengthening the Forcing Cone, Back Boring the barrel and Porting at the Muzzle.
These mods working together made this gun a pleasure to shoot. I shot about 250 rounds of 12ga. ammo including 175 Birdshot, 40ea. 00 Bucks, and 35ea. Federal Low Recoil Slugs.
The results were very positive.
Last time I came home with a big bruise on my cheek and a pinch mark on my neck, and my right shoulder was a pretty red color for a week after. None of that this time. The recoil is very controllable and very tolerable.
The biggest change was the Vang Comped Barrel. The recoil is now strait in line with the barrel. There is no muzzle flip due to the barrel porting, and the recoil impulse is much smoother due to the back boring and lengthening of the forcing cone. This was definitely $200 well spent, and the perceived recoil was NOTICABLY LESS! My un-bruised shoulder and cheek are the proof of that!
The gun performed perfectly throughout the whole class.
The Buck Shot pattern was 4" at 15 yards and the birdshot Pattern was @7" at 15 yards, and well under the Vang Comp claims,,, thus making the gun a super viable HD gun.
Slugs shot to POA at 50 yards, mainly because I sighted the gun in before we left for Nevada, but I still managed to put 3 slugs in the 3x4" Head Box at 50 yards,,, offhand! (all that pellet gun shooting I've been doing definitely paid off.)
I have to say the Vang Comp Mods to my barrel and my Bro in laws barrel really made a difference and we would both recommend the process to anyone setting up a Tactical Shotgun. This has nothing to do with a field gun so don't waste your time in that regard.
Hans Vang has been doing these mods for 40 years and they definitely work.
